Breast Cancer Therapy



Lack of clinical trial data may hinder treatment decision-making in older women



December 29th, 2005

The lack of clinical trial data may hinder treatment decision-making in older women.

According to investigators in the United States "Node (+) breast cancer represents over 40% of cases in older women and currently there is a debate whether adjuvant therapy for all older women is cost-effective. [The purpose of our study was] to evaluate if adjuvant treatment for early-stage (Stage I-IIIa) node (+) breast cancer with hormone therapy, chemotherapy, or combination therapy is cost-effective in older patients."
